Today we’d like to introduce you to Khalid Nazim
Hi Khalid, can you start by introducing yourself? We’d love to learn more about how you got to where you are today?
Ever since I was a child, I’ve been fascinated by the art of filmmaking. I remember the first time I watched Jurassic Park—those two iconic scenes where we see the park in its full glory and the scene where the T-Rex makes its grand entrance left me absolutely spellbound. The incredible blend of visuals and storytelling sparked a deep curiosity within me and ignited a lifelong passion for filmmaking.
Growing up in an Indian middle-class family, pursuing such a dream was challenging, but I couldn’t shake the desire to delve deeper into this captivating world. I started exploring everything related to filmmaking: direction, music, editing, cinematography—every aspect that contributes to the magic on screen. My curiosity led me to experiment with making videos using my digital camera, often roping in friends to create short films. What started as a hobby soon transformed into a burning passion, and I knew I had to take it further.
Eventually, I took the plunge and bought a professional camera. That decision marked a turning point in my life. It felt like stepping into a new realm where I could finally bring my ideas to life with greater clarity and creativity. I began working professionally, directing and editing music videos, films, and commercials. Each project taught me something new and pushed me to expand my skills even further. I also took the opportunity to learn about sound design and visual effects, contributing to various projects with these additional talents.
Despite the challenges along the way, I have always embraced the less-traveled path, finding fulfillment in every opportunity to tell stories that resonate with audiences. My journey has just begun, and I am eager to continue exploring new horizons and collaborating with talented individuals who share my passion for storytelling. I look forward to creating more impactful projects and pushing the boundaries of what filmmaking can achieve.

Appreciate you sharing that. What else should we know about what you do?
I am an independent filmmaker based in Assam, in Northeast India. Over the years, I’ve worked on numerous projects as an editor, cinematographer, and colorist, allowing me to be comprehensive and diverse. I have directed several music videos and short films as well
Although I graduated with a degree in law, my passion for filmmaking pulled me towards a different path and made me pursue this art form professionally, and it has been an incredibly rewarding journey.
